Arjun Sambamoorthy heads AI Engineering and Research at Cisco, where he leads Cisco AI Defense—a product dedicated to securing the use of AI. As Senior Director of Cisco’s AI Engineering organization, Arjun helps guide the development of next-generation AI systems that support innovation across networking, security, observability, and infrastructure. Before joining Cisco, Arjun co-founded Armorblox (acquired by Cisco), where he pioneered the application of natural language understanding to protect organizations from email-based threats. With a strong technical background and over a decade of experience building large-scale products at the intersection of AI and cybersecurity, Arjun focuses on practical solutions that deliver real value for customers.

Introducing the Cisco LLM Security Leaderboard: Bringing Transparency to AI Security

4 min read

Today, Cisco launched the LLM Security Leaderboard, a comprehensive resource for evaluating model risk and susceptibility to adversarial attacks. By providing transparent, adversarial evaluation signals, this leaderboard contextualizes model performance metrics against evaluations of how models handle malicious prompts, jailbreak attempts, and other manipulation strategies. The tool empowers organizations with a clear, objective understanding of model risk by mapping threats to our AI Safety and Security Framework taxonomy, and informs defense-in-depth approaches to AI deployments.
